Functionality/Accessibility

Navigation, embedded objects, links, and all Google Docs function properly.

Poor

All internal pages are linked together through a navigational bar, but organization needs great improvement. Few internal and external links work properly. Few external links open in a new window. Few embedded objects function properly. Few Google docs are published.
Fair

All internal pages are linked together through a navigational bar, but organization can be improved. Not all links to internal and external pages work properly and not all external links open in a new window. Not all embedded objects function properly. Not all Google docs are published.
Good

All internal pages are linked together through a navigational bar in a somewhat organized fashion. Though links to both internal and external pages work properly, not all external links open in a new window. All embedded objects function properly. All Google docs are published.
Excellent

All internal pages are linked together through a navigational bar in an organized fashion. Links to both internal and external pages work properly, and external links open in a new window. All embedded object function properly. All Google docs are published. Image sizes do not exceed 35K.

Layout/Format/Text

Page consistency, type choice/size/alignment, paragraph length, image flow, readability/attractiveness.

Poor

Pages lack consistency. Type size/color/placement for titles and body text is not consistent on five or more pages. Text alignment varies from page to page. Paragraphs may not be short or readable. Bullets and numbered lists reflect alignment issues. Image placement lacks thought and images do not flow together well. The overall website lacks readability and attractiveness.
Fair

Pages have an inconsistent look. Type size/color/placement for titles and body text is not consistent on 3-4 pages. Text is primarily aligned to the left (not centered). Paragraphs may not be short or readable. Bullets and numbered lists reflect alignment issues. Image placement is mostly appropriate, but the images do not flow together well. The overall website is somewhat readable and attractive.
Good

Pages have a somewhat consistent look. Type size/color/placement for titles and body text are consistent, except for 1-2 pages. Text is primarily aligned to the left (not centered). Paragraphs are short and readable. Bullets and numbered lists may have alignment issues. Image placement is mostly appropriate and images flow together. The overall website is readable and attractive.
Excellent

Pages have a consistent look. Type size/color/placement for titles and body text should be consistent on all pages. Text is aligned to the left (not centered). Paragraphs are short and readable. Bullets and numbered lists flow well. Image placement is appropriate and images flow well together. The overall website is extremely readable and very attractive.
